Output 6f667bc877203a4f4520c02ae20461c0fb93df154f86a64682b24a08e77a09ed:0

value
12657855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e45db3fa0d34edae067a329a578d89ef4523a8 OP_EQUAL
address
3FAzptiubUWZTEFHXKvRD3sGmZ8qmi8BqP
transaction
6f667bc877203a4f4520c02ae20461c0fb93df154f86a64682b24a08e77a09ed
spent
true